CEREBRAL-RENAL CONNECTIONS OF ELDERLY AGED PEOPLE IN THE REPUBLIC OF SAKHA (YAKUTIA), SUFFERING FROM CHRONIC ISCHEMIA OF BRAIN

abstract 0881304068 issue 88 pp. 971 – 984 30.04.2013 ru 1568
The study included 245 patients from 60 to 89 years, comparable by age and sex, were divided into two groups according to region of residence (Arctic and Antarctic), for two age groups (elderly and senile age) and by the sex. The main method of the study of cerebral hemodynamics in this work has been ultrasound dopplerography (usdg). Doppler sonography survey with color scanning and spectral Doppler analysis of the cervical arteries on extracranial level was performed according to standard method for ultrasound systems ACUSON “Sequoia-512” sensor linear format of the generated frequency of the ultrasonic signal 4 and 8 MHz in the ever-wave mode. The entire sample investigated the functional state of the kidneys. GFR was determined by the settlement formulas; Cockcroft&Gault GFR= (140-age) × body weight (kg) 810* creatinine of blood (mol/l)×E, where E-1,23 for men, 1,04-for women and MDRD: GFR= 186×(creatinine of blood mg/dd)-1,154 × (age)-0,203 × (0,742 for women) with subsequent determination of the stages of chronic kidney disease. We used a brief MDRD formula, which of laboratory indicators requires only establishing the values of concentrations of serum creatinine

REGIONAL ETHNIC FEATURES ELDERLY AGE PEOPLE THE REPUBLIC OF SAKHA (YAKUTIA) WITH VARIOUS TUPES OF CVS

abstract 0881304056 issue 88 pp. 786 – 800 30.04.2013 ru 2224
We have studied the electrical activity of the brain of 345 patients with cerebrovascular disease, of whom 139 patients with ischemic stroke (IS) in the carotid, 206 patients with chronic cerebral ischemia (CCI) dyscirculatory encephalopathy stage 1 (DE-1) -91 patients, with 2 DE stage (DE-2) -115 patients. All the observations were divided into two categories, generally includes four main groups of observations, and control. Criteria of the division of main category were the observations of the region of residence and nationality. In the analysis of the EEG of patients with ischemic stroke, the dominant slow-wave activity was recorded in all cases. In patients with HIM, the changes in the bioelectric activity of severe degree were diffuse
